选择sql中不为空的行

din*_*eep 4 sql

为什么下面的代码在 SQL 中不起作用

SELECT * 
FROM DATA
WHERE VALUE != NULL;
Run Code Online (Sandbox Code Playgroud)

Dha*_*val 6

我们不能将 null 值与=进行比较我们在 sql 中比较 null 值的特殊运算符 IS OPERATOR

SELECT * 
FROM DATA
WHERE VALUE is not NULL;
Run Code Online (Sandbox Code Playgroud)

Null 不是任何 Value.Sql 将 Null 视为Unknown/asence of data